    You cry, you yell, you snarl, you fidget…

    You fight it with all the strength that you gather within…

    You sit in dilemma, pretending to decide to not know what it is…

    Whilst your mind does and so does your heart…

    At one instance, You want to break the chain and stop the pain…

    At another, You cling onto it knowing, its a part of you..

    Weren’t you taught to love yourself with all that you got? – flaw or perfection?

    You do you, they say – you don’t understand how..

    Probably you do, but don’t you think that is all you have left of the world?

    You’ve feared companionship and have craved it simultaneously…

    Doesn’t this seem like the game of hide and seek, where you feel belonged?

    You feel ‘important’, for you know they are the only ones true to you?

    They pay a visit even when you least ask for it…

    May be that is why you decide to let it remain, but with a condition…

    You control them, and not they control You!

    You control the Monster!

    Thank you for submitting this very intense poem.  Such strong feelings come through and you have maintained the mood all throughout the poem.  I do believe your poem would benefit from imagery.  Words like “important” could be transformed into an image that would help the reader become more involved in the poem and the emotions.  “Important” as what?  You feel like a “God” or  “storm clouds” that block the sun.  You have an abundance of feeling in your poem, now give us some beautiful word pictures so we can experience your words on a sensory level.  Really enjoyed reading your poem and thank you again, for sharing.  – Susan
